" Overview
House Network Ltd are delighted to offer for sale this three bedroom back to back mid terraced house with spacious accommodation over four floors. The layout comprises of hall and lounge to the ground floor, the basement is made up of a kitchen and dining area. The first floor comprises of bedroom two and three and a shower room. The second floor is the master bedroom, outside there is a courtyard garden to the front of the property. The property is deceivingly spacious and covers approx 1170 sq ft.

The location is well served by local amenities with shops and schools close by. For the commuter access to the national motorway network is within a short drive, railway stations are available at Deighton which is a quarter of a mile away and Huddersfield which is one and three quarters miles from the property.

Other benefits worthy of mention are gas central heating, double glazing, accommodation over four floors, the size of which has to be viewed to be fully appreciated.

VIEWINGS ARE VIA HOUSE NETWORK LTD.
